I just bought a flame angel as the first fish in my new tank, and I already have some zoas and other corals in there. He nips at the rocks but not at the zoas yet. I was wondering since he is not eating brine shrimp or pellets if I could put those strips of algea hanging from a mag float and get him to sucessfully eat? Thanks for the help
 
Flame Angels can be very territorial and you may find your self having difficulty adding any other fish to the tank after the fish makes its self at home.

My flame angel does not eat the nori. At first my flame angel did not accept forzen food, however it did pick at the live rocks, sand and glass. After about a week it started accepting brine and mysis shrimp and spirulina flakes. However, all the frozen food that it does eat is always the smaller pieces. It tries to take the larger shrimps and spirulina flakes but spits them back out. I am guessing that it may have trouble swallowing them.
 
My flame eats formula one and nibbles at the Romaine I hang for my tangs. Most of the time it just eats what ever is on the rocks.
 
My flame eats Hikari Marine 'S' and 'A' pellets, brine, mysis, plankton, and LOVES nori (I use my Mag-Float too, stupid clips always break or have lousy suction cups). One new addition to his diet that I'm not thrilled about is turbo snails - he picks at them relentlessly until they fall off the glass, and then it's a feeding frenzy for all the angels. I think I'm going to have to remove the remaining snails; once he discovered he could knock them down, he made it his full-time hobby :rolleyes:
